Amblyopia is a neurodevelopmental condition in which one eye fails to achieve normal vision because the brain suppresses its input during the critical period of visual development. It affects approximately 2–3% of the population worldwide and is the leading cause of preventable monocular vision loss in adults under 40. In Bangalore's academic and technology environment, undetected amblyopia can silently undermine a child's school performance or a professional's career - without triggering an obvious visual complaint. The condition is fully treatable at any age with structured binocular vision therapy.

Current evidence: Dichoptic training - presenting different images to each eye simultaneously to break suppression - is now the leading evidence-based amblyopia intervention for older children and adults. The 2011 PEDIG trial demonstrated that treatment is effective up to age 17; subsequent adult binocular therapy studies confirm meaningful gains beyond this. The American Optometric Association endorses binocular amblyopia therapy over patching alone for superior suppression reduction and stereoacuity outcomes.

What Is Amblyopia and Why Doesn't Patching Fix It?

Amblyopia is not a disease of the eye - it is a disease of the brain's visual processing. The eye may be structurally normal, but the brain has learned to suppress or ignore its input during development. This is why glasses and patching alone often fail to achieve lasting results: they change what the eye sees, but they do not reprogram how the brain processes visual information.

Binocular and dichoptic vision therapy targets the neural suppression directly - presenting controlled, simultaneous visual input to both eyes and training the brain to use them together. Three Types of Amblyopia - Each Requires a Different Approach

Accurate differential diagnosis is the foundation of effective amblyopia treatment - treatment design varies significantly by type.

Refractive Amblyopia

A large prescription difference between the two eyes (anisometropia) causes the blurrier eye to be suppressed over time. Often invisible - no eye turn, no obvious signs - making it the most commonly missed type at Bangalore school vision screenings. Only a proper binocular vision evaluation detects it.

Strabismic Amblyopia

A misaligned eye (squint/strabismus) leads the brain to suppress the deviated eye to prevent double vision. The turn may be constant or intermittent. Binocular vision therapy addresses the suppression and eye teaming deficit alongside or after structural treatment - surgery alone does not cure amblyopia.

Deprivation Amblyopia

A physical obstruction - cataract, ptosis, or corneal opacity - prevents one eye from receiving clear visual input during development. Less common but most severe in impact. Requires prompt intervention to clear the visual axis, followed by intensive binocular vision rehabilitation.

Amblyopia Treatment for Bangalore Adults - Not Just Children

The belief that amblyopia can only be treated in early childhood has been overturned by modern neuroscience. Brain neuroplasticity persists throughout life, and dichoptic training for adult amblyopia has strong research support. Caring Vision Therapy regularly treats adult lazy eye via telehealth - with sessions scheduled around Bengaluru's demanding tech-sector and startup work culture, without requiring time off for clinic travel.

Results in adults take longer than in children - typically 36–52+ weeks versus 12–20 weeks - but meaningful functional improvement in acuity, suppression depth, and stereopsis is achievable. My son's school in Koramangala does annual vision tests and he always passes - how can he possibly have amblyopia?
School vision tests check whether a child can read a Snellen chart with both eyes open together - they do not test binocular function, suppression, or individual eye acuity under the conditions that reveal amblyopia. A child with amblyopia in one eye routinely passes these tests because the dominant eye compensates. The only reliable way to detect amblyopia is a functional binocular vision evaluation that tests each eye independently, assesses suppression depth, and evaluates stereopsis. In Bengaluru's school environment, this distinction matters - many children with amblyopia are only discovered after their parents notice academic or sports difficulties and request a specialist evaluation.

Does heavy screen use in Bangalore - tablets for homework, phones, online classes - make amblyopia worse in children?
Heavy screen use does not directly cause or worsen amblyopia - amblyopia is a neurodevelopmental suppression that develops in early childhood. However, sustained screen work in an untreated amblyopic child does two things: it masks the condition (the brain compensates so well that parents and teachers don't notice a problem), and it places asymmetric visual demand on the dominant eye, accelerating fatigue. The Bengaluru context - online school, coding apps, educational tablets - means amblyopic children spend more time in conditions where suppression is active and unchallenged. This is precisely why early functional evaluation matters more in high-screen-time environments.
